Ontario has announced it is raising the non-resident speculation taxon homes purchased by foreign nationals from 20 percent to 25 percent, effective Tuesday. Finance Minister Peter Bethlenfalvy says the move makes Ontario’s tax rate the highest in Canada and seeks to discourage foreign speculation. Ontario Raises Foreign Homebuyer Tax, Makes It Provincewide
Ontario is increasing a tax on non-resident homebuyers to 20 percent and expanding it to cover the whole province.
